In 395 AD the Roman Empire split in two for the final time – never again would one man rule the whole empire. Whilst the eastern part continued in one form or another for a thousand years, the western part entered a period of rapid decline. Whilst the exact date for the fall of the west is subject to debate, it is generally considered to have ceased to wield any influence by the end of the fifth century.
